Eiii Ghana! The Indiana Pacers dem surprise the Oklahoma City Thunder for Game 1 of the NBA Finals wey happen on Thursday night. The Pacers chop victory 111-110, wey spoil the Thunder demma home advantage. Cason Wallace, the young star wey start the game for Thunder, replacing Isaiah Hartenstein, play ein heart out but e no dey enough.
Before the game, plenty people bin dey expect the Thunder to win, especially as dem be 9.5-point favorites for DraftKings Sportsbook. But the Pacers, wey be NBA Finals debutants since 2000, show say dem come serious. Dem fight hard, led by Tyrese Haliburton ein skills and Myles Turner ein strong presence for inside.
Cason Wallace ein starting role be big surprise. At 21 years and seven months, e be the youngest player to start NBA Finals game since Tyler Herro for Miami Heat inside the bubble for 2020. E play well, but the Pacers defense dey tight, wey make am difficult for am and ein teammates to score easy baskets.
The Thunder bin use the same starting five – Shai Gilgeous-Alexander, Lu Dort, Jalen Williams, Chet Holmgren, and Hartenstein – throughout the Western Conference playoffs. So, Wallace ein inclusion show say the coach dey try some new things to slow down Tyrese Haliburton wey be the key man for Indiana.
